Located on the campus of Wheaton College, the Billy Graham Museum chronicles the history of Christian evangelism in North America and the life and ministry of Billy Graham. Through artifacts, multimedia exhibits, and immersive displays, visitors explore the impact of evangelism on society and Graham's profound influence on the world.

Getting There

  • Public Transport

    From downtown Chicago, take the Metra Union Pacific West Line train from Ogilvie Transportation Center to the College Avenue station in Wheaton. From the station, walk four blocks west on College Avenue to Billy Graham Hall on the Wheaton College campus. Check the Chicago METRA system for current fees and schedules. A one-way trip costs around $6-$8.

  • Walking

    From downtown Wheaton, walk east on College Avenue towards the Wheaton College campus. The Billy Graham Museum is located in Billy Graham Hall at 500 College Avenue, approximately a 5-minute walk from downtown. There are sidewalks along College Avenue for pedestrian access.

  • Driving

    The Billy Graham Museum is located at 500 College Avenue in Wheaton, Illinois, on the Wheaton College campus. Visitors can use designated "W" or "W/C" parking spaces in the lot adjoining Billy Graham Hall. Parking in these areas may result in a non-registration notice, which visitors can return to the Parking Office at no charge. Daily Fee parking is available for $2 per day at the Wheaton Place Garage (232 W. Wesley), Top Floor, using the Passport Parking app or website.

The Billy Graham Museum, found on the campus of Wheaton College in Wheaton, Illinois, offers an inspiring journey through the history of Christian evangelism and the remarkable life of Billy Graham. Since opening in 1980, the museum has welcomed thousands of guests each year, providing a unique visual overview of Christian mission and its impact on American society. The museum's exhibits begin with the early history of America and culminate in a powerful presentation of the Gospel message. Visitors can explore the Rotunda of Witnesses, featuring stunning tapestries depicting significant figures in Christian history. The Life and Ministry of Billy Graham exhibit showcases his journey from aspiring baseball player to world-renowned evangelist, including videos, texts, and gifts from world leaders. A walk-through presentation of the Gospel provides a stirring three-dimensional experience of the Christian message. The museum also hosts temporary exhibits, ensuring a fresh and engaging experience for returning visitors. The Billy Graham Museum is more than just a historical archive; it's an inspirational center dedicated to training Christ-followers in sharing their faith. It aims to extend visitors' understanding of the good news about Jesus, inspiring them to follow Christ and share the Gospel with others.
